Firmus Raises $2 Billion to Enhance AI Infrastructure, Achieves Valuation Exceeding $10.5 Billion

Firmus has successfully secured $2 billion in funding to accelerate the development of its AI infrastructure across the Asia-Pacific region. Notable investors such as NVIDIA, Coatue, Blackstone, and Jane Street have contributed to the company's valuation of $10.5 billion. The initiative, known as Project Southgate, will establish multiple AI data centers, beginning in Melbourne with a deployment of 18,400 GPUs. However, the energy and water requirements for Firmus's new projects have sparked discussions regarding policy implications and community concerns in Australia.
